Yara India inks biostimulant marketing agreement with Sea6 Energy

Share this article

Yara India, part of Oslo, Norway-based Yara International, has signed an agreement with Bengaluru, India-based startup Sea6 Energy to market and distribute its biostimulant AG Boost.

Yara India will market the product across India through its network of over 3,500 dealers and 980 Yara Crop Nutrition centers in 18 states.

AG Boost, launched under the brand Nourish, is a liquid formulation that can be administered to crops in multiple formats such as foliar spray, fertigation/drip irrigation systems, or through soil, seed and root application.

Sea6 was founded in 2010 by a group of IIT Madras alumni, and is currently situated in the Centre for Cellular and Molecular Platforms, Bangalore. Sea6 will produce AG Boost at its production facilities in Tuticorin, India and Bali, Indonesia.
